Handover: SquatWatch scanner, from Dren to Malik. Cron scans the Pexbin registry hourly; flagged names land in the triage queue. False-positive list lives in the repo root — keep it sorted. The vault holding the signing key was resealed Tuesday after the audit. If you need to unseal it before my return, use the recovery passphrase below.

unlock words, hahip-baduf: holwyn-istath-julvan

Minutes — Management Meeting, Loyalty Programme Overhaul

Present: heads of department, chaired by T. Varga. The meeting reviewed the redesign of the Amberpoint Rewards scheme, agreeing to retire tier three and consolidate points expiry rules by next quarter. Finance will model redemption liability; marketing will draft member communications. The confidential business-plan note follows immediately below.

internal memo for kaduf-baduf: Only 35 of the 378 pilot accounts renewed Holir, so a churn review is set for June 11. Eliielax Group is in early talks to buy Silaelix Group for about $142.1 million.

Team,

This release replaces the per-canvas undo stack in Sketchloom with a unified history service. Grouped edits (multi-select drags, connector reroutes) now collapse into a single undo step, and redo survives a canvas switch. Maintainers should note that history entries are serialized diffs, not full snapshots, so memory use dropped roughly 60% on large diagrams. Plugin-initiated mutations must register through the history API or they will be skipped. The exact build is recorded below for traceability.

pipeline stamp: htk31_f769b577b3028a4e9958e5bb8d1259a

Subject: Hotfix shipped for session-token refresh bug

Hi all — especially those new to the Farrowgate release channel: we shipped a hotfix today for the session-token refresh bug in Gatewarden 2.9. Tokens refreshed within 30 seconds of expiry were occasionally issued with a stale signing key, forcing users to re-authenticate. The fix rotates the key reference atomically during refresh. No action needed from clients; servers picked it up automatically at deploy. For audit purposes, the exact hotfix build is identified by the token below.

pipeline stamp: htk9_ce63042d9